Ethereum activity regains five-month high as DeFi, smart contracts, stablecoin transfers peak

Ethereum’s on-chain activity continued to grow, extending to a five-month peak based on gas usage. The surge is driven by more DeFi interactions, smart contract activity, and stablecoin usage. 

Ethereum’s activity regained a five-month peak based on gas usage. Increased interest in DeFi and DEX trading, smart contract usage, and stablecoin transfers. ETH transfers have also increased, recently surpassing USDC transactions. 

Ethereum on-chain activity surges to a five-month peakETH gas usage surged to new records, boosted by DeFi, stablecoin usage, and new smart contracts. | Source: Etherscan

Daily gas used jumped to a peak in the past three months and remains at a high level. Ethereum engagement with the L1 chain is also higher in the past few months, while L2 activity slowed down, based on Grow The Pie data.

L2s are still highly active in terms of revenues, taking up over 15% of the economic activity, while leaving Ethereum’s L1 with the bulk of liquidity. 

Ethereum daily active addresses also increased to around 550K daily, a slightly higher baseline. Usually, periods of increased ETH activity have coincided with bull markets, setting expectations for a re-test of previous ETH records. 

ETH gas is spent on smart contracts, stablecoins

One of the reasons for ETH traffic is the reasonably low price of gas. Despite the heightened activity, ETH has used L2 scaling to achieve lower costs. Currently, on the main network, DEX swaps are back down to $0.21, while gas prices are under one gWei. 

Tether remains the most active smart contract, followed by Circle. DeFi is the top category of gas burner apps, destroying 48 ETH per day based on the regular token burn rate. As the ETH’s popularity has grown, a phishing smart contract has also snuck into the ranks of the top 3 gas burners.

Additional activity comes from routers and aggregators, underscoring the increased demand for DEX trading and perpetual futures activity. Other sources of activity include incentives to forge an Ethereum Gas User identity by minting NFTs. 

ETH recovers above $4,000

Demand for DeFi, a growing supply of stablecoins and general attention for ETH helped the price recover to $4,164.23. ETH still expects a breakout to a higher price range, despite facing short-term turbulence for derivative traders. 

The coin also saw increased demand for DeFi based on the growing liquidity in lending protocols. Ethereum’s ecosystem holds over $89B in total value locked, with Aave locking in over $32B. 

Liquidatable ETH positions from lending have also doubled, up to $2.2B from their usual levels of $1B. Smaller loan positions start at the $3,600 range, while bigger positions are in the $1,800 per ETH range, with more accumulated just under $1,400. Previously, the bulk of loans was at below $1,000 per ETH, showing a lower taste for risk. 

The increased drive for lending and risk-taking shows a recovery after the October 10-11 market crash. ETH showed its resilience, with most of the liquidations on centralized markets. The quick recovery and growth of ETH activity showed the market is far from capitulating.

FedEx (FDX) Q1 2026 Earnings

FedEx (FDX) Q1 2026 Earnings

The post FedEx (FDX) Q1 2026 Earnings app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. A Fedex truck is seen during heavy traffic on Sept. 16, 2025 in New York City. Zamek | View Press | Corbis News | Getty Images FedEx beat on the top and bottom lines in its fiscal first-quarter earnings report on Thursday. The stock rose more than 5% in after-hours trading on Thursday. “Our earnings growth underscores the success of our strategic initiatives, as we are flexing our network and reducing our cost-to-serve, while further enhancing our value proposition and customer experience,” CEO Raj Subramaniam said in a statement. Here’s how the company performed in the first fiscal quarter, compared with what Wall Street was expecting based on a survey of analysts by LSEG: Earnings per share: $3.83 adjusted vs. $3.59 expected Revenue: $22.24 billion vs. $21.66 billion expected The package delivery company posted net income of $820 million, or $3.46 per share, for the first fiscal quarter ended Aug. 31, compared to $790 million, or $3.21 per share, in the year-ago period. Adjusted for FedEx Freight spin-off costs and other changes, the company posted net income of $910 million or $3.83 per share. Average daily volumes in the U.S. saw an increase of 6% overall, the company reported. FedEx said segment operating results saw improvements this quarter due to higher domestic package volumes, but the FedEx Freight segment operating results fell due to lower revenue and higher wages. The company said it sees revenue growth in 2026 in the range of 4% to 6%, compared with a Wall Street estimate of 1.2%. FedEx expects full-year earnings per share for fiscal year 2026 at $17.20 to $19, which is a midpoint of $18.10, compared with an estimate of $18.21. FedEx is continuing the process of spinning off FedEx Freight into a new publicly traded company, with an expected completion date…
